Iris MVC Method Result
Iris has a very powerful and blazing fast MVC support, you can return any value of any type from a method function
and it will be sent to the client as expected.
* if `string` then it's the body.
* if `string` is the second output argument then it's the content type.
* if `int` then it's the status code.
* if `error` and not nil then (any type) response will be omitted and error's text with a 400 bad request will be rendered instead.
* if `(int, error)` and error is not nil then the response result will be the error's text with the status code as `int`.
* if `custom struct` or `interface{}` or `slice` or `map` then it will be rendered as json, unless a `string` content type is following.
* if `mvc.Result` then it executes its `Dispatch` function, so good design patters can be used to split the model's logic where needed.
The example below is not intended to be used in production but it's a good showcase of some of the return types we saw before;
package main
import (
"github.com/kataras/iris"
"github.com/kataras/iris/middleware/basicauth"
"github.com/kataras/iris/mvc"
)
// Movie is our sample data structure.
type Movie struct {
Name string `json:"name"`
Year int `json:"year"`
Genre string `json:"genre"`
Poster string `json:"poster"`
}
// movies contains our imaginary data source.
var movies = []Movie{
{
Name: "Casablanca",
Year: 1942,
Genre: "Romance",
Poster: "https://iris-go.com/images/examples/mvc-movies/1.jpg",
},
{
Name: "Gone with the Wind",
Year: 1939,
Genre: "Romance",
Poster: "https://iris-go.com/images/examples/mvc-movies/2.jpg",
},
{
Name: "Citizen Kane",
Year: 1941,
Genre: "Mystery",
Poster: "https://iris-go.com/images/examples/mvc-movies/3.jpg",
},
{
Name: "The Wizard of Oz",
Year: 1939,
Genre: "Fantasy",
Poster: "https://iris-go.com/images/examples/mvc-movies/4.jpg",
},
}
var basicAuth = basicauth.New(basicauth.Config{
Users: map[string]string{
"admin": "password",
},
})
func main() {
app := iris.New()
app.Use(basicAuth)
app.Controller("/movies", new(MoviesController))
app.Run(iris.Addr(":8080"))
}
// MoviesController is our /movies controller.
type MoviesController struct {
// mvc.C is just a lightweight lightweight alternative
// to the "mvc.Controller" controller type,
// use it when you don't need mvc.Controller's fields
// (you don't need those fields when you return values from the method functions).
mvc.C
}
// Get returns list of the movies
// Demo:
// curl -i http://localhost:8080/movies
func (c *MoviesController) Get() []Movie {
return movies
}
// GetBy returns a movie
// Demo:
// curl -i http://localhost:8080/movies/1
func (c *MoviesController) GetBy(id int) Movie {
return movies[id]
}
// PutBy updates a movie
// Demo:
// curl -i -X PUT -F "genre=Thriller" -F "poster=@/Users/kataras/Downloads/out.gif" http://localhost:8080/movies/1
func (c *MoviesController) PutBy(id int) Movie {
// get the movie
m := movies[id]
// get the request data for poster and genre
file, info, err := c.Ctx.FormFile("poster")
if err != nil {
c.Ctx.StatusCode(iris.StatusInternalServerError)
return Movie{}
}
file.Close() // we don't need the file
poster := info.Filename // imagine that as the url of the uploaded file...
genre := c.Ctx.FormValue("genre")
// update the poster
m.Poster = poster
m.Genre = genre
movies[id] = m
return m
}
// DeleteBy deletes a movie
// Demo:
// curl -i -X DELETE -u admin:password http://localhost:8080/movies/1
func (c *MoviesController) DeleteBy(id int) iris.Map {
// delete the entry from the movies slice
deleted := movies[id].Name
movies = append(movies[:id], movies[id+1:]...)
// and return the deleted movie's name
return iris.Map{"deleted": deleted}
}
